thanks for the compliments, guys!
As you can probably see, I've added running boards and front fender flares already. I've changed the red 3rd brake light to a white one (I still don't understand why the 04 and 05 4.8is's came with white but the 06 came with a red one), and have also added the titanium trunk trim piece. I have most of the other titanium pieces already (less then window surroundings, I actually like the shadowline), just waiting for the weather to warm up a little so I can spend more time outside for the door handles. Thinking of putting in a set of focal 165KP3s in, too .. anybody have any good advice for upgrading the audio without doing anything crazy?
